Be inspired

Incredible local experiences to enjoy on your holiday

The accommodation you selected was characterful and charming as well as being perfectly located for all the sites.

Mr and Mrs J Service Devon, England

  • Lets plan your holiday

    Get in touch for expert help and advice

    Contact us

  • Call

    • UK 020 8191 7640
    • Spain +34 93 407 1269
  • Sign up to our newsletter

    Receive our seasonal travel offers, news and recommendations.

    Get the news